Usb Control /Status Register 0 (Usbcsr0) - Renesas H8S/2158 User Manual

16-bit single-chip microcomputer h8s family/h8s/2100 series
Table of Contents

Advertisement

18.3.11 USB Control /Status Register 0 (USBCSR0)

USBCSR0 controls the operation of the USB function core.
USBCSR0 is initialized to H'00 by a system reset or function software reset (see section 18.3.16,
USB Control Registers 0 and 1 (USBCR0, USBCR1)).
Bit
Bit Name Initial Value R/W
7 to 4 —
All 0
3
EP0STOP 0
Section 18 Universal Serial Bus Interface (USB)
Description
R
Reserved
These bits are always read as 0 and cannot be modified.
R/W
Endpoint 0 Stop
Used to protect the contents of endpoint 0 FIFO in the
USB function core. Setting this bit to 1 protects the data
that is sent to the EP0 OUT-FIFO by a SETUP
transaction.
0: Indicates that the EP0 OUT-FIFO and specific FIFO is
in an operating state.
[Clearing conditions]
System reset
Function software reset
1: Indicates that the EP0 OUT-FIFO is in a read stop
state.
[Setting conditions]
FVSR0O contents are not changed by reading
EPDR0O.
Indicates that the EP0 specific FIFO is in a write or
transfer stop state.
FIFO contents are not changed by writing to EPDR0I.
FVSR0I contents are not changed by setting EP0ITE.
Rev. 3.00 Jan 25, 2006 page 581 of 872
REJ09B0286-0300

Advertisement

Table of Contents
loading

Table of Contents